ARTICLE AD BOX
You don't have permission to access "http://www.ndtvprofit.com/technology/100-liquid-cooling-nvidia-unveils-tech-that-could-nearly-eliminate-data-center-water-use-11673792" on this server.
Reference #18.121cc517.1782183795.775efc0a
https://errors.edgesuite.net/18.121cc517.1782183795.775efc0a
1 hour ago
8




English (US) ·